From some years ago, a family kayak outing on the Bon Secour River. It feeds into Mobile Bay, Alabama. What I read is that way way back sailing ships used to sail up into the river to refill their water barrels as the water was known to be very pure and clean. Our family kayaked the Bon Secour many times until our outfitter went out of business.
